Top 10 Foods to Make with Applesauce

Top 10 Foods to Make with Applesauce

Applesauce is in large supply during the fall months, and there are many ways to use it besides eating it plain. Keep reading to see my top 10 ways to use applesauce in your cooking.

Applesauce Bread: Use flavored appleasauce, such as raspberry or cranberry, and it will be extra special.

Applesauce Loaf: Using applesauce in this recipe keeps the bread moist while add delicious flavor.

Applesauce Muffins: Using applesauce and a little bit of oil instead of butter keeps these muffins healthy, moist and flavorful.

Applesauce Doughnuts: A fun twist on traditional donuts you'll probably eat them as soon as they come out of the fryer.

Applesauce Cookies: Cinnamon, nutmeg, cloves and allspice make this a perfectly seasoned cookie sweetened with apple sauce for a healthy twist.

Applesauce Snickerdoodles: This is one of my kids favorite cookies. They are so good and fluffy with a hint of apple and cinnamon taste.

Applesauce Brownies: These low-fat muffins are made with applesauce instead of oil, and come out very moist and delicious.

Applesauce Fruitcake: Using applesauce along with shortening doesn't cut down on the fat content, but it keeps cake moist and delicious – perfect for your holiday table.

Applesauce Bars: Usher in the fall season with these tasty bars, made with home-style applesauce and pumpkin pie spice.

Kugel with Applesauce: This sweet kugel is unforgettable!
